Material Handling Armstrong Terminal, Inc. specializes in dry-bulk material handling. Our capabilities include the loading and unloading of river barges, railcars, and trucks.

Warehousing
Indoor
Armstrong Terminal, Inc. has approximately 250,000 square feet of indoor storage
space. Our six-story concrete bulk material warehouse comprises approximately
212,500 square feet. This facility is ideal for storing bulk material with
moisture content requirements. Additional indoor storage facilities are ideal
for packaged goods and containerized warehousing or limited bulk material storage.

Outdoor
In addition to indoor storage, ATI has approximately five acres of outdoor
storage. This is ideal for bulk product without moisture content requirements.

Transloading
In addition to traditional dry-bulk handling techniques, our facility can trans-load your material as follows:
- Railcar to Truck
- Railcar to Barge
- Truck to Railcar
- Truck to Barge
- Barge to Railcar
- Barge to Truck
For trans-loading applications, our facility utilizes a Cambelt Trans-loader. Finer dry-bulk and bagged material is trans-loaded using a Westfield auger.
ATI is served directly by the Kiski Junction Railroad with interconnection to the Norfolk Southern Railroad.

Packaging and Blending
ATI can also package your product according to your specifications. We have the capability of packaging bulk material into containers ranging in size from 10 lbs. bags to one-ton supersacks. In addition, we have the capability of blending material to your unique specifications.
